Large-Deal Discount Policy (Managers Only)

Scope: all Drayfield Industrial deals above the large-deal threshold. Standard cap: 18%. Exceptions require pricing committee approval; no verbal commitments. Discounts stack with no other promotions. Quarterly audit of exception usage; repeat breaches escalate to the board. Policy reviewed annually. Effective immediately across all territories. The confidential business-plan note below provides context for these limits.

management briefing: Project Ulavan slips by two quarters because of the staffing delay.

### Changed Defaults — Pondrel Pool Manager 2.8

On-call folks, read carefully: we've reduced the default maximum pool size from 50 to 20 connections per replica and shortened the idle-connection timeout. This prevents the connection exhaustion we saw against the Varnholt cluster last month, but it means saturation alerts will fire earlier and at lower thresholds. If you get paged for pool exhaustion, check queue depth before scaling. The new shipped defaults are as follows.

service settings:
[casax]
port = 6379
team = rusir
host = casax.zemvarhq.corp
region = outer-4
access_code = ac_9808ce
timeout_ms = 1500

# Setup for Pingwick, our deploy-status chat bot.
# Pingwick polls the Shipgate release API every thirty seconds
# and posts results to the team channel. Keep the poll interval;
# Shipgate rate-limits aggressively. If messages stop, check
# Shipgate health first, then this client. The client
# authenticates to Shipgate using the internal key below.

service key, yadug-bajog: zpat3_pou